Drawn & Quarterly #1
“A Dear John Letter from Your Dog on Moving Day”
Chris Oliveros kicks off the first issue of Drawn & Quarterly with a personal note on the magazine’s mission, setting the tone for a publication rooted in thoughtful, independent storytelling. The issue features a table of contents and indicia that establish the series’ identity, with the cover by Anne D. Bernstein capturing the quiet, introspective spirit of the project.

Short introduction by Chris explaining why he is publishing the kind of magazine he is. Also includes table of contents with creator's names and indicia. Indicia states "Drawn and Quarterly".
